Output 3851a5191e90da23734e266a68876dac2e655b32ef55b33b506c4ddc9a228a93:16

value
65638167
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 139447e48b04c419caf1394ab7267e89793581c5 OP_EQUALVERIFY OP_CHECKSIG
address
LM1UjbCsDFDJ3agLFXpqvgzYUWodT8we9n
transaction
3851a5191e90da23734e266a68876dac2e655b32ef55b33b506c4ddc9a228a93
spent
true